Commit Graph

12067 Commits

Author SHA1 Message Date
Robert Muir c024c2e341 LUCENE-3728: add note to this infostream that it includes docstores
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/branches/lucene3661@1237842 13f79535-47bb-0310-9956-ffa450edef68
2012-01-30 17:50:08 +00:00
Robert Muir 8421cdfbb9 LUCENE-3728: remove outdated nocommit, not relevant since we dont repack CFS on addindexes
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/branches/lucene3661@1237822 13f79535-47bb-0310-9956-ffa450edef68
2012-01-30 17:37:17 +00:00
Robert Muir 4e620c58da LUCENE-3728: remove separateFiles mess, remove CFX from IndexFileNames, preflex codec handles this hair itself
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/branches/lucene3661@1237820 13f79535-47bb-0310-9956-ffa450edef68
2012-01-30 17:33:52 +00:00
Robert Muir 3cab173f7c LUCENE-3728: doesn't need to be instance
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/branches/lucene3661@1237771 13f79535-47bb-0310-9956-ffa450edef68
2012-01-30 16:40:55 +00:00
Robert Muir cdc68d0921 LUCENE-3728: remove unnecessary code from SCR
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/branches/lucene3661@1237768 13f79535-47bb-0310-9956-ffa450edef68
2012-01-30 16:38:50 +00:00
Robert Muir 846338c0dc LUCENE-3728: push compound shared doc stores reading into 3.x codec (only 3.0 indexes, only a hit if you also have vectors)
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/branches/lucene3661@1237746 13f79535-47bb-0310-9956-ffa450edef68
2012-01-30 16:02:37 +00:00
Robert Muir 668dea8016 LUCENE-3728: remove obselete TODO
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/branches/lucene3661@1237714 13f79535-47bb-0310-9956-ffa450edef68
2012-01-30 15:22:11 +00:00
Robert Muir c99756201d LUCENE-3728: split stored fields into 3x/4x so more docstore stuff can go in 3x
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/branches/lucene3661@1237713 13f79535-47bb-0310-9956-ffa450edef68
2012-01-30 15:19:32 +00:00
Robert Muir 1e60692bd7 consistent error messages for size mismatch
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/branches/lucene3661@1237682 13f79535-47bb-0310-9956-ffa450edef68
2012-01-30 14:36:38 +00:00
Robert Muir dae9070d1f LUCENE-3728: remove nocommit
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/branches/lucene3661@1237641 13f79535-47bb-0310-9956-ffa450edef68
2012-01-30 13:20:09 +00:00
Robert Muir 7487fb30f3 LUCENE-3728: tidy up copySegmentAsIs/sharedDocStore logic
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/branches/lucene3661@1237637 13f79535-47bb-0310-9956-ffa450edef68
2012-01-30 13:10:47 +00:00
Robert Muir d9a73590a8 LUCENE-3728: stop invading the codecs files() for this assert
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/branches/lucene3661@1237627 13f79535-47bb-0310-9956-ffa450edef68
2012-01-30 12:52:29 +00:00
Robert Muir 438ec3ce0b LUCENE-3728: consistently deprecate all 3.x codec classes
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/branches/lucene3661@1237295 13f79535-47bb-0310-9956-ffa450edef68
2012-01-29 14:13:11 +00:00
Robert Muir 9c22385c55 LUCENE-3728: don't pass Directory to files, its confusingly never CFSDir like other Directory parameters, its rarely needed in files(), and redundant with SI.dir
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/branches/lucene3661@1237294 13f79535-47bb-0310-9956-ffa450edef68
2012-01-29 14:07:32 +00:00
Robert Muir 8d98a6d270 LUCENE-3728: 3.x codec files() privately adds compound docstores
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/branches/lucene3661@1237280 13f79535-47bb-0310-9956-ffa450edef68
2012-01-29 13:18:16 +00:00
Robert Muir 5d96aa30c1 LUCENE-3728: really make separate norms totally private to 3.x codec
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/branches/lucene3661@1237272 13f79535-47bb-0310-9956-ffa450edef68
2012-01-29 13:02:32 +00:00
Robert Muir a5c5bbbffe LUCENE-3728: PreFlex codec privately handles old CFS-without-CFE in files()
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/branches/lucene3661@1237266 13f79535-47bb-0310-9956-ffa450edef68
2012-01-29 12:43:37 +00:00
Robert Muir 146033c757 LUCENE-3728: SI.files() always calls Codec.files()
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/branches/lucene3661@1237263 13f79535-47bb-0310-9956-ffa450edef68
2012-01-29 12:32:32 +00:00
Robert Muir 80bf691b3b LUCENE-3728: handle separate norms more privately inside 3.x codec
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/branches/lucene3661@1237261 13f79535-47bb-0310-9956-ffa450edef68
2012-01-29 12:24:47 +00:00
Robert Muir 1f5e23be14 recreate branch
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/branches/lucene3661@1237250 13f79535-47bb-0310-9956-ffa450edef68
2012-01-29 11:39:51 +00:00
Robert Muir 36cc6e315c LUCENE-3661: move deletes under codec
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1237245 13f79535-47bb-0310-9956-ffa450edef68
2012-01-29 11:33:46 +00:00
Robert Muir adb2bdbcea merge trunk (1237128:1237241)
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/branches/lucene3661@1237242 13f79535-47bb-0310-9956-ffa450edef68
2012-01-29 11:21:24 +00:00
Mark Robert Miller 9d8a62ce96 if there is an exception when closing the writer, log it and keep closing
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1237200 13f79535-47bb-0310-9956-ffa450edef68
2012-01-29 03:41:37 +00:00
Mark Robert Miller 210301b424 SOLR-3065: Let overseer process cluster state changes asynchronously
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1237194 13f79535-47bb-0310-9956-ffa450edef68
2012-01-29 02:22:55 +00:00
Mark Robert Miller 9a1222efc5 SOLR-3063: Bug in LeaderElectionIntgrationTest
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1237193 13f79535-47bb-0310-9956-ffa450edef68
2012-01-29 02:12:00 +00:00
Mark Robert Miller 23e845d479 enable this test again
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1237191 13f79535-47bb-0310-9956-ffa450edef68
2012-01-29 01:55:30 +00:00
Mark Robert Miller 6d5e8df1da raise the timeout on this test
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1237190 13f79535-47bb-0310-9956-ffa450edef68
2012-01-29 01:53:55 +00:00
Yonik Seeley 817b1e3fe0 SOLR-3066: don't fail for searcher open/close mismatch
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1237140 13f79535-47bb-0310-9956-ffa450edef68
2012-01-28 19:02:39 +00:00
Robert Muir 0e570cd5a2 merge r1237083
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/branches/lucene3661@1237129 13f79535-47bb-0310-9956-ffa450edef68
2012-01-28 18:24:05 +00:00
Robert Muir 8933cfe181 LUCENE-3661: nuke nocommit for real, split SimpleText to use read-only bits impls whenever it can
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/branches/lucene3661@1237127 13f79535-47bb-0310-9956-ffa450edef68
2012-01-28 18:22:49 +00:00
Michael McCandless 1b8d8b4350 LUCENE-3661: simplify del count tracking during merge
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/branches/lucene3661@1237114 13f79535-47bb-0310-9956-ffa450edef68
2012-01-28 17:59:45 +00:00
Robert Muir 613cd64f31 deprecated hook for separate norms should not be abstract: 4.x codecs use a clean api
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1237083 13f79535-47bb-0310-9956-ffa450edef68
2012-01-28 16:13:24 +00:00
Robert Muir 509ad87610 LUCENE-3661: fix TODO, pass core to these SR ctors and remove code duplciation
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/branches/lucene3661@1237077 13f79535-47bb-0310-9956-ffa450edef68
2012-01-28 15:47:08 +00:00
Robert Muir 59bdbb04c0 LUCENE-3661: remove MutableBits from SegmentReader, add back nocommit
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/branches/lucene3661@1237075 13f79535-47bb-0310-9956-ffa450edef68
2012-01-28 15:32:13 +00:00
Robert Muir 1e538244af LUCENE-3661: make Lucene3x codec really completely readonly
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/branches/lucene3661@1237070 13f79535-47bb-0310-9956-ffa450edef68
2012-01-28 15:13:36 +00:00
Robert Muir df204bc54b merge trunk (1233476:1237067)
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/branches/lucene3661@1237068 13f79535-47bb-0310-9956-ffa450edef68
2012-01-28 15:04:12 +00:00
Robert Muir 8684b78e1e LUCENE-3661: javadocs
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/branches/lucene3661@1237067 13f79535-47bb-0310-9956-ffa450edef68
2012-01-28 14:59:48 +00:00
Robert Muir 59b122522b LUCENE-3661: remove nocommit
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/branches/lucene3661@1237066 13f79535-47bb-0310-9956-ffa450edef68
2012-01-28 14:43:04 +00:00
Robert Muir 77d161f043 LUCENE-3661: make this nocommit a TODO, i am out of ideas
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/branches/lucene3661@1237065 13f79535-47bb-0310-9956-ffa450edef68
2012-01-28 14:35:56 +00:00
Robert Muir b44abb2aaf LUCENE-3661: removable MutableBits.clone()
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/branches/lucene3661@1237064 13f79535-47bb-0310-9956-ffa450edef68
2012-01-28 14:34:18 +00:00
Michael McCandless d79594dd14 LUCENE-3661: remove MutableBits.count()
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/branches/lucene3661@1237057 13f79535-47bb-0310-9956-ffa450edef68
2012-01-28 13:23:40 +00:00
Michael McCandless e1a808d489 drop 100% deleted segments before merging
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/branches/lucene3661@1237038 13f79535-47bb-0310-9956-ffa450edef68
2012-01-28 10:43:52 +00:00
Mark Robert Miller 7a0a470401 tweak test and pull atLeast() out of for loop
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1236968 13f79535-47bb-0310-9956-ffa450edef68
2012-01-28 03:03:46 +00:00
Mark Robert Miller ece30470f2 try making sure we wait for any recovery to stop for each core in core container shutdown
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1236959 13f79535-47bb-0310-9956-ffa450edef68
2012-01-28 02:19:42 +00:00
Mark Robert Miller 1c24188e0b don't add to the num open count until the constructor is finished
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1236958 13f79535-47bb-0310-9956-ffa450edef68
2012-01-28 02:17:37 +00:00
Mark Robert Miller 5a020a48d2 change test so that even if there is an exception in the ClientThread constructor, the zkclient is closed
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1236956 13f79535-47bb-0310-9956-ffa450edef68
2012-01-28 02:03:29 +00:00
Mark Robert Miller d3fa5ea86e try raising how long we will wait for balanced open/close
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1236939 13f79535-47bb-0310-9956-ffa450edef68
2012-01-28 00:24:32 +00:00
Steven Rowe 97d62cc383 Fix offset array assertion off-by-one
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1236912 13f79535-47bb-0310-9956-ffa450edef68
2012-01-27 22:43:48 +00:00
Yonik Seeley f6e22fd4fa SOLR-3035: make text response writers work with byte, short, and byte[] values
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1236894 13f79535-47bb-0310-9956-ffa450edef68
2012-01-27 21:27:57 +00:00
Mark Robert Miller cc93925b9f don't allow registering a new SolrCore if the CoreContainer has been shutdown
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1236889 13f79535-47bb-0310-9956-ffa450edef68
2012-01-27 21:19:08 +00:00